Insulating glass
Insulating glass is a kind of glass that helps buildings become more efficient in their energy usage. It is a suitable choice for a wide range of applications. It is suitable for commercial curtain walls, double-glazed windows overhead glass, and a variety of other applications.
The primary function of insulating glass is to reduce the transfer of heat from the inside to the outside. This lowers heating and cooling costs. Insulating glass also offers excellent sound insulation.
A typical insulated glass structure consists of two or more panes, and an open spacer. The spacer could be made from aluminum or thermoplastic. Metal spacers conduct heat, and can cause condensation to form on the bottom of the sealed unit.
A second spacer is used to increase the efficiency of thermal processes. These spacers contain the element argon that is thicker and more stable than air. It is not poisonous. The window could collapse if it leaks.
Insulating glass can be enhanced by tinted and reflective glass. The interior ply of glass can also be treated to enhance its thermal properties. Additionally, the outer ply can be coated with a low-e.
Insulating glass can also help reduce condensation. Desiccant is used to eliminate the moisture that could condense on the glass. Combining a dark shade with desiccant can reduce glare.
IG units typically come with a 10-year or 25-year guarantee. The length of time is contingent on the type of materials employed, the quality of workmanship, and the location of the installation.
Insulating glass is a great choice for building all-glass façades. It can also be used to construct internal profiled facades and also for sound control and seismic requirements.
Many companies offer a way to repair IG units that have failed in the UK.

Vacuum glazing
Vacuum glazing is an innovative type of double glazed window that is more energy efficient than conventional glass. It can be utilized in both existing buildings and on new constructions. The system is based on micro-spacers that make sure that the panes are not touching each their counterparts.
It also has a very small gap, around 10ths of a millimeter width. This makes it highly efficient in creating a space that is insulated. This lets the unit provide the same thermal insulation as a conventional double glazed unit, without the additional expense of installing an insulating dessicant.
In addition to preventing heat from escaping from the home the vacuum-insulated units reduce condensation on the interior of the windows. The ability to keep your home cool in the summer is a great way to save money.
Vacuum-glazed windows can also provide excellent levels of acoustic insulation. Although it's not offering the same level of noise reduction as triple-glazing, they are much quieter than standard single-glazed units.
These units are also a great option for conservation areas. They are thin enough to fit in the traditional single-glazed grid for heritage.
Another benefit of these units is that they are also lead-free and 100% recyclable. These units are highly sought-after for retrofit applications. They can be positioned between the transom and mullions on traditional timber frame windows.
They can reduce heating costs by their superior double glazing window repair performance. Unlike conventional double glazed sash windows glazed units, vacuum insulated units don't require planning permission.
They can be used in new windows as well as to update single pane windows in older homes. House owners who reside in period homes are often concerned about maintaining the original style of their house.
